  28. Middle Brother
  29.  
  30.  
  31. A work exploring the Korean adoptee experience.
  32.  
  33. Review: Eric Sharp’s new play, directed by Robert Rosen to open Mu’s season, follows Korean adoptee Billy (Sharp) as he travels back to Korea for the first time. Weighty themes of personal and cultural identity are mixed with plenty of comic moments in this heartfelt and often compelling dramedy. (Lisa Brock)
